DOE

The U.S. Department of Energy's Office of Environmental Management appointed Connie Flohr as manager of the Idaho Cleanup Project in Idaho Falls. Flohr was deputy manager of the radioactive waste cleanup program for nearly three years, and was acting manager since November. She has over 30 years of experience in leadership, budgeting and planning. Environmental Management oversees cleanup at the Idaho National Laboratory Site.
